Abstract :
As a part of on-going research gait studies among children, this paper presents a preliminary study on kinematic parameters of walking gait among children. In this study, angles of hip, knee, ankle and pelvic will be collected at Human Motion and Gait Analysis Laboratory, UiTM Shah Alam. There are 16 healthy children consists of 10 boys and 6 girls aged between 6 to 12 years old participated in this study. Each parameter will be analyzed to investigate the differences of walking gait in children for both genders. This study will be focused on the kinematic parameters at anatomical plane, which are sagittal, frontal and transverse planes. From the result, the differences walking gait pattern occurred generally at frontal plane at angle of hip, ankle and pelvic and at transverse plane differences occurred generally at angle of hip.
